I am with mike on this one.
I just don't see how if you pop a Lyrica pill you will wheel over to the fridge and eat 2 pieces of cake. See Steve Garro's posts for an example of a guy who works out as much as he can despite neuropathic pain and taking meds with listed side effects of weight gain - it is hard to do aerobic work with just your arms. You have to modify caloric intake and get as much exercise as your shoulder and elbow joints ( and you back) will allow - daily. Body weight is based on caloric intake versus calories burned. |

Topomax will help with the weight, but comes with some other really bad side effects. I took the stuff for four months, it made me a complete blooming idiot by week three, I couldn't form a sentence, I couldn't think of names for people or things (like.....I am going to get in my car <--couldn't think of what to call the car), I would forget what I was doing 2-seconds after I started doing it, etc. If that wasn't bad enough, by week six, it also causes your hair to fall out in clumps, globs, and once you stop it all never grows back.
Wellbutrin would be a better choice, but it has to be the name brand and the XL, for some reason the generic is missing some property and doesn't work right. |

Topomax is probably the only neuropathic pain med that actually is associated with weight loss. This is caused by decreased appetite.
Topomax can be effective for neuropathic pain, but is not a "first line" pain medicine. But if other meds are not effective or side effects are not tolerable, it is something to try. The most common complaint is that it makes you feel tired/more confused etc... People knick-name it "Dopemax". But not everyone has these problems, and if it works for you.... great! You have to have your blood monitored periodically on this one. And there is a long list of side effects, including some heart ones and birth defects if you are a pregnant young woman. Topomax is actually one of the components of a new "weight loss pill" that the FDA is thinking of approving (combo of Topomax + an amphetamine). This was kind of shocking to me, as Topomax has a lot of side effects. It tells you how desperate we are in this country to get people to loose weight, that the FDA would even consider passing this. They FDA already rejected approval of it once. I wouldn't favor trying Lyrica if you haven't tried Neurontin already. Lyrica was supposed to be the "new Neurontin" with fewer side effects, but it has actually been shown to be more sedating with more edema/weight gain then Neurontin. Newer isn't always better. The main down side of Neurontin is that most people get more benefit if they take it 3-4 times per day, which is less convenient. |
